TWO // Baby Shower Gift
It's been a hot minute since I've been to a baby shower, but our friends are expecting in June so I attended the shower last weekend. We met down south last winter and decided to get away together again this past February. We became fast friends and are thrilled for them! My go-to gift for a baby shower is to assemble a basket of essentials. I always start with a plastic storage bin of some sort as I find it's a useful thing to gift new moms. Because, you know, with babies comes lots of stuff! This time around I found this adorable Lego-top bin, I mean, how cute? I decided it was so cute in fact that I would wrap the contents from the inside. I filled the box with a cute outfit (inspired by baby's dad's personal style), a baby nail clipper, some baby Tylenol, a set of long-handled spoons, a berry feeder, some snazzy sunglasses and a book for baby's library. My husband suggested the Jungle Book and I thought it was a great classic to have for a little later. I try to think of the little things that can often be overlooked but that end up being handy when the time comes.
